HOW TO MAKE A UPMA
Semolina, also referred to as suji or rava, is used to make the popular South Indian breakfast dish known as upma. Here is a straightforward recipe for upma:
Instructions:
-Cumin and mustard seeds are added to hot oil in a pan. Let them cough.
-Add chopped green chilli, ginger, and onions. Onions should be sautéed until translucent.
-Mixture of vegetables should be cooked for a few minutes until just tender.
-Add the semolina (rava/suji) and roast for 3 to 4 minutes, or until it is fragrant and light brown.
-To taste, add salt and water. Mix thoroughly to eliminate lumps.
- Once the water has been absorbed and the upma is cooked, cover the pan and cook it on low heat for 5-7 minutes.
- Add lemon juice after turning the heat off. Mix thoroughly.
- Serve hot and garnish with coriander leaves.
